The global responsibility of this position and all positions within the department of Imaging Services is to provide quality diagnostic images, comfort, and care for patients and employees at KVH.  As a part of this, all employees are responsible for seeking ways to provide input to continuously improve our operation and procedures.  The MRI technologist is responsible for reviewing imaging requests for appropriateness, verification of physician orders, and performance of the procedure in a safe, caring and timely manner.  In addition, the MRI technologist must consistently produce quality images for the radiologist to interpret and report to the requesting physician.  They must maintain a high level of professional expertise and assumes the responsibility for professional growth and development.  The art and practice of diagnostic magnetic resonance imaging requires in depth knowledge of human growth, human anatomy and physiology, proper anatomical positioning, normal and abnormal pathology and physiological responses, disabilities, manifestations of diseases and trauma.

Qualifications

What is required...

  • Graduation from a Radiology education program under the Joint Review Committee on Education in Radiologic Technology (JRCERT)
  • ARRT registration as Radiologic Technologist
  • ARRT MRI certification or registry eligible with successful completion of certification within 6 months of hire.
  • Current Washington State DOH Radiologic Technologist Certification
  • Current American Heart Association BLS

What is preferred...

  • One years’ experience in MRI
